I'm a fan of Hamlet. I've been a fan of Shakespeare in general and Hamlet in particular since high school. This has led me to reading the different versions of the play multiple times, seeing it live, and watching a buttload of movie and TV adaptations (can I get a hellz yeah for Slings & Arrows ya'll???). This has also led to lots of crying, but that's neither here nor there.
The main point, friends, is To Be or Not To Be: A Chooseable-Path Adventure is the best, most rigorous, thorough, and feminist adaptation of Hamlet I have ever had the joy to read. If you're a fan of the Dane, you must read it.
